    Resthaven Finalist in Two ACSA Award 2017 Categories

    Resthaven is thrilled to be to a finalist in not one, but two categories in the Aged and Community Services (ACS) SA and NT Awards for Excellence this year.

    ‘Our first finalist is the “Spirituality in the Garden” program at Resthaven Marion, in the “Innovation in Service” Award,’ says Resthaven CEO, Richard Hearn.

    ‘The program, launched in 2016, has successfully redefined worship with an “interactive” style, focussing on spirituality and the individual.’

    ‘Our second finalist is Resthaven Palliative Care Nurse Practitioner, Peter Jenkin for the “Employee” Award.’

    ‘This award recognises the dedication and contribution of an individual employee in the delivery of services to older people, or those with a disability.’

    ‘With his professionalism, skill, and genuine compassion and care shown for residents in their final stages of life, Peter is deserving of recognition.’

    ‘We are very proud of Resthaven’s achievements, and extend our congratulations to Resthaven Marion, and Peter Jenkin for their recognition as finalists in the 2017 ACS Awards.’
